## Service Accounts — `resizeq` CLI

The `resizeq` CLI handles batch image resizing for the Marlowby asset pipeline. It runs under the `svc-resizeq` account, which has write access only to the derived-assets bucket. Jobs over 5,000 images are chunked automatically; failed chunks retry twice before landing in the dead-letter queue. On-call: if the queue backs up, check the worker pool in the Marlowby console before restarting anything. The CLI authenticates to the asset service with the internal key listed below.

service key, yadug-bajog: zpat3_pou

TICKET QV-2291: Encoding sniffer drops DB connections under load

The charset detection service for uploaded text files on Briarhop opens a new pool per request instead of reusing the shared one. Under batch uploads (>200 files) we exhaust connections and detection falls back to UTF-8 blindly, mangling legacy Shift-state files. Fix: hoist pool creation to module scope, cap at 20. To reproduce against the staging metadata store, connect using the string below.

replica DSN, kajep-yahag: mssql://praok_svc:iF@db-8d68.plorvaio.local:5432/eliion

Replica lag alarm (Quillbase cluster): fires at 30s lag. First check the vacuum job on the primary; second, confirm the Lanmoor replica isn't snapshotting. If lag exceeds 5 minutes, fail reads back to primary via the router flag. The router needs its auth token set in the env file, on the line right after this sentence.

sealed setting: LEDGER_TOKEN5=bcca1

Internal Memo — Proposed "Meridian Plus" Tier

To the board of Fennwick Digital: we propose launching Meridian Plus, a mid-range subscription tier priced between Basic and Enterprise. Modeling suggests 11% of Basic users would upgrade within two quarters, with minimal cannibalization of Enterprise. Support costs were reviewed carefully and remain within tolerance. A phased rollout beginning in the Larchport market is recommended, pending the board's direction below.

board note of fahag-tajop: The eastern region missed its Julix quota by 44.0 percent last quarter. Ralionax Holdings plans to lower the Druath list price by 61.8 percent in March. The board signed off on a budget of $295.0 million for Project Gilath. The renewal with Ruswynix Systems closes at $274.5 million a year, 17.0 percent above the last contract.